1. SUCCINCT BIOGRAPHY.
Born 25 January Bucharest. Parents, Bucharest: Father, Lawyer George. Slama, son of Armand and of Theresa Vucovici, from Viena.( Young Artillery officer in the 1st War 1916 - 1918, „Hero” at Marasesti, Oituz, with many high decorations, studied Law and left Army, became Judge then a successful Lawyer, entered Politics, a Liberal Leader, rallied to the young outstanding Historian Gheorghe Bratianu --- both against „Bolshevics” and supporting Romania rights for Bassarabia ---, was arrested in 1952, no trial, died under arrest, close to the „Canal Danube-Black Sea”, the Communist Dictatorship extermination campus). Mother, Maria, (house) ”nationalized” in 1949 (therefore she had to suffer politically, proposed, in 1953, for deportation to Baragan, with her daughter and son-in-law, studies in an excellent private School for young ladies,”Pompilian”, a wonderful character, dedicated to her child – who adored her — and to her husband (she --- the thin, frail woman -- carried for several years a heavy knapsack with food etc. to husband in various. prisons, and was the greatest support for her daughter and son-in-law life, helping them as a true saint); she was the daughter of Nicolae Constantinescu --- who came alone, when 6 years old, from a village near Bucharest, because persecuted by his stepmother, and became a merchant of peasant clothes --- and of kindest young girl Maria Banescu, from Bucharest, who became the vivacious full of humour and love Grandmother, the same as the child’s beloved Aunty Lina, still alive younger sister of the great-grandmother / She married, end 1949, with Assist. Prof. Boris Cazacu --- who came to Bucharest from Kishinev when 17 years old, as a brilliant scholarship winner ---, later on he became Full Prof., Corresp. Member of Academy; they married at Townhall on 22 Dec. 1949, with Al. Rosetti as official „Witness”, and had the Religious Wedding on 25 Dec. at home, in clandestinity - because this was forbidden (Atheist Regime) for Boris as a member of PCR, but also for her, as a university teacher // She had a normal childhood, with a reciprocal adoration Mother - Child, in the changing World and new „Romania” of the inter - Wars Era. Beloved at home, wonderful education in ordinary „democratic”: Schools, then at Bucharest University, with friendly girl-mates.

From 11 to 18 years old she was a „Cercetasha”(„Girl-Scout”), and never forgot the „Law” (N.B. long before „Communism”, in Capitalist Romania!):”A Cercetasha doesn’t make difference in religious belief, social class or fortune”./ Especially after 1950, she and close family lived the heavy, hectic life in Communism, with troubles even at home, with perquisitions, the Commission for „Nationalisation”, the invasion by night of Securitate for arresting Father, cold because Gas-restrictions, economies for Food, Fear in any moment, and obliged to change the aspect of the beautiful house built in 1902 by Grandfather (where the ancient owners were but tollerated), and to accept, because of the two rooms considered as „extra”, a completely unknown family and an old man, (Collocatari ”Living together”, compulsory inmates, see „Ninotchka”, the famous movie with Greta Garbo!). In 1975, after her Mother’s death, they moved to a much smaller flat, close to Academy, bought by Father in 1946, inherited when the ancient owner died. The beautiful old House, in historical Calea Rahovei, was demolished in 1984, with bull-dozers, by order of Ceausescu, as many other old beautiful houses, for building the monstruous Casa Poporului „People(Nation)’s House”, greatest building (after 1990, the Parlianent) and one of its large Avenues.


Happy holidays in a small house built by maternal Grandmother at Bushteni (face to highest Mountains Bucegi. with e.g.” The [natural] Sphinx”. and the „Babe”, i.e . „Old women”, all carved by thousand years-wind). She used to prepare there exams, and also face to over 25oo m. Caraiman she wrote e.g. future Langage et contexte . She climbed when 6 years old up to Omul (”The Man” (2500m),. as her first excitingly great event, and further on was extremely in love with mastering the high peaks. After 1975, built a small cottage at Breaza, close to Hills --- trees with delicious fruits, planted Abieses („fighting” for them all), with dominating green colour, grass, flowers, clear air, plenty of bike tours on the old strongly German manufactured „Madam” Gőricke.


Studied with pleasure, in Bucharest, all permanent activities also there, with War events, various „Revolutions” and Dictatorships.

Late 1949, when the Communist Regime made the „Education Reform”, she was insidiously included (by Prof. M. Ralea, G. Zapan, Al. Rosetti) in the list of Nominations for the Faculty of Psychology. A bit before, Prof. Mihail Ralea received her in a morning, at home, and, both standing for all this talk, crucial for her, the tall, always successful man --- who confessed however once that he had been a „timid”---, said peremptorily: ”There are only three ways: ESCAPING [abroad], ADAPTING [i.e.to overtly collaborate with the new Commuist Regime], or SUICIDE”. The young „Miss Slama”, who didn’t expect such a verdict or exhortation, hesitated but a second and replied, respectful but firm --- without even knowing what she meant about, however obviously rejecting the three options with all her young revolt against such a future life for her ---: ”I think there is something else”. He looked disconcerted for a while, but didn’t ask her „What?” (maybe thinking that she alluded to some violent opposition, which she didn’t mean at all! But in any case he always supported her). She didn’t know herself „What?”--, maybe it was just a refusal of his cynical slogan, and she felt afterwards, for years, as in a whirl, struggling much, working with passion, without puting in question „what for?”, never thinking to accept Ralea’s first two options — e.g.to „remain” in another country even when she had great successes abroad, but having however been educated to love her country and mastering the word Patriotism not as a mere cliché --. As for the third, yes, she sometimes thought of for choosing that option (see the”Avatars” which must be reminded, revealed by those who lived such horrors, and which are intermingled in a C.V. with our „Activities”, Publications). She went on however in a continuous „Dynamics”.— she wrote once that like the „Nachtwandler” in Brahms’ Lied, and maybe only the Geto-Dacian „Sphinx” knows wherefrom such a surprizing – apparent ! ---„vitality”, as foreign colleagues said, comes from.
A Latin „slogan”, that she later on selected as a Motto, suddenly came to her mind when 14 years old (she carved it, in a holiday, on the arm of a wooden lounge chair ---chaise longue--- in the garden at Bushteni, but she didn’t think of it as to a compulsory cliché, though it probably acted in her subconscient): «Labor omnia vincit improbus».
2 STUDIES. DIPLOMAS.
A „Career” broken in its start by the Historical_Politics, determining tragical life of Parents, drammatical changes in her life, break of a well-promising situation at University and generally as a Writer too, of a Young Girl of middle-class Family also. Taking another Way --- from Italian studies towards Psychology, then from University teaching entering into strict Research activity only, and as a result also, moving to Psycholinguistics. Strange coimpensations, arriving unexpectedly: as the paradoxical benefit of having the ”obligation” of only doing Research, which she transformed into an immense pleasure and a wonderful chance; submitted to political persecution but surviving with immense Working efforts, such that she deserved the loyal help of some Romanian scholars --- as Mihail Ralea, Al. Rosetti, I. Iordan---, but mostly of outstanding foreign personalities such as e.g. Roman Jakobson (and even of Soviet ones, as A. Luria, A. N. Leontiev, V. Artemov a.o. among distinguished Psychologists and Linguists), and also of a marvellous respect and support from many colleagues abroad In the „milder” 1960s, she had even success at home, in spite of her „bad dossier”: Parents political situation, and especially her refusing to be a „Member of the Party” (the Communist one, i.e. accepting to be considered as a supporter of the Regime --- even if many weren’t), and to be dominated by the clichés and manipulations of the 1946-1989 Dictatorship. But almost every success was „counterbalanced” by a „thunderbolt”, see some avatars below. And further on, after 1990, feeling obliged to remain a nonconformist.

Studies and principal activities in Bucharest. I. Primary School (4 years). ”Regina Maria” (Patriarchy area), Lyceum (8 years) „Domniţa Ileana”.Her „Selected Author” at Baccalaureate,was the brilliant satirist I. L. Caragiale.

Then 4-5 years: University of Bucharest, Faculty of Letters and Philosophy (denonations of those times). Some excellent Professors: Al.Marcu (Italian), Tudor Vianu (Aesthetics), Al. Busuioceanu (History of Arts, Consultant of King Carol II for his Art Collection), G. Zapan, later on M. Ralea (Psychology), N. Cartojan (Old Romanian Literature), G. G. Antonescu, I. Gabrea (Paedagogy), D. Gusti, T. Herseni (Sociology) a.o./ 1942 Licence (MA) in Philosophy (Psychology, Paedagogy, Aesthetics) ---- with a Thesis (whose topic was suggested by her Professor G.Zapan, Doctor in Berlin with the Gestalt psychologist W. Kőhler): „ Associationism and Structuralism in Language Behaviour studies”). And 1943 Licence (MA) in Letters, Modern Philology (Italian, History of Arts). with a Thesis whose title was given by Prof. Al. Marcu: „The Realism in Pirandello’s Theater”, published as a little book, 1943, with a new view on Pirandello, namely his „Realism”: even in his most expressionistic plays). // 1946 „University Paedagogical Seminar” (as specialities, entitling for teaching: Romanian, Italian, Psychology, Paedagogy, Philosophy), with 10, the highest mark./. 1946 „Concurs” (Contest called „Capacitate”, a National Examination - Competition for Teaching qualification*in her case,teaching „Paedagogy”; getting the highest mark,she won the First place at National level ) /

1944-1946, enrolled for Doctor’s degree in Italian, with her former Professor, the most distinguished Italianist and excellent pedagogist, Alexandru Marcu. As he had done the most absurd step for such a Scholar in those times --- who also was not a politician ---, to accept the function of a Minister (and even of „Propaganda”!), in the Government of Marshall Ion Antonescu toward its end, after 23 sugust 1944 he got at first the punishment of „Domiciliu Obligatoriu” „DO” (Compulsory Residence, at home, under the „Services” watching), then a trial and was in prison, dying there in 1955 („Rehabilitated”in the 1960s). Knowing or not of the great danger, the young Doctorand called up and visited her Professor in his „DO”, in order to present him the „Plan” of the projected Thesis (on „Pirandello and Modern Tragicism”, on which he wrote his agreement: ”It can be a Thesis”). In 1947 he was already in prison., and for the young D.rand the way to ”Italian studies” was closed, so she had to give up with Italian studies and moved towards Psychology, continuing her Licence Thesis, with a new view on Structuralism, developing the new direction of Contextualism in her new Thesis (with experiments too, 1947-1948) and preparing the alleys for Psycholinguistcs. // In 1949. a new dramatic --- if not even tragic --- event:she was forbidden to defend the Ph Thesis („Teza de doctorat”) in Psychology, in fact, nothing was said to her, but the Commission was not allowed by ”The Party” (PCR) to be present. The day had been officially announced for 24 June 1949). The Thesis was the future „Limbaj si context”1959, Langage et contexte 1961, and the Commission had got since long the manuscriptum. The Doctorand was alone in the Faculty office of the Auditorium, the Secretary of the University (sent by Rector, Al.Rosetti, to see what was happening) entered and asked her „What are you doing, Miss?”, and she answered: ”I am here, but the Commission did not come”. Next day, the Dean and (formal) Director of the Thesis, Mihail Ralea, wrote a „Procčs Verbal” ( no. 1377/25 VI 1949), lying, namely that the Commission had no time to read the voluminous Thesis…, and that . ”Miss T. Slama is not guilty of anything”, therefore it was proposed to postpone the event for „autumn (1949)” (but it was already known that the new Law would appear, transforming the „Doctorate” and the title of „Doctor” into the Soviet system of „Aspirantur” and the „Candidate” title --- which implied humiliating exams, Marxism, ideologic - political adhesion, all actions to which TSC --- her husband too --- did not accept to be submitted). The „Procčs verbal” was signed by Al. Rosetti, M.Ralea, Gh. Zapan, I. Bălănescu, M.Beniuc, E.Weigl (the strong Stalinist Al. Graur had opposed against her --- as he did during all 5o’s ---, and Balanescu too;he was a politically powerful complexed young man nephew of M.Roller, interested in such stratagems, because he had a low background, never wrote a scientific paper in 2o years of career, until he left Romania forever, in 1969, with family.) That 1949 official paper served (after tens of years !), in 1965, to Ilie Murgulescu, President of the Academy, who invited TSC to give him that „Proces verbal”, because he ”needed one or two such papers”, in order to support the abolishment of the Soviet „Aspirantur” in Romania and to come back again to the former system bringing to the title of ”Doctor”. As a consequence o this new Law, the former Doctorand, whose drama --- determined by political absurdities of dictatorship --- „served” after such a laps of time, got her Doctor degree („Doctor in Psychology”). But in 1966 (for marking her protest, she presented now as a Thesis the book „Relations between Language behaviour and Thinking in ontogenesis”). Already on that occasion, her Professor, Gh. Zapan, underlined that she deserved getting already the new superior Title of „Dr. Docent in Sciences”, delivered for „a long scientific activity, …of a great value, representing outstanding contributions for the progress of science”. She got this Title in 1969, on the basis of a Report on all scientific results so far, defended with a Commission composed of Linguists (Academicians I. Iordan and D. Macrea) and Psychologis (V.Pavelcu and Al.Rosca), with a spontaneous report by Al.Rosetti ---. The title was no more allotted after around 1974 (by interfering of Elena Ceausescu), but it was not abrogated, it can be used. and it is beared by a few persons / 1946 Exams forTranslator from and to French and Italian.

3.SCIENTIFIC - PROFESSIONAL ACTIVITIES Teaching, Research Functions. Some Avatars (Brief presentation)
I. Functions. 1948. Substitute Teacher Paedagogical Lyceum.
/ 1949 - Nov. 1952 Assist. Prof. Univ. Buc. Faculty of. Psychology (expelled in Nov.1952, for political reasons – father’s political fate, adding the fact that not only she didn’t recant, disavoid him as it was the use, but she went to see him in Aug. 1952, when he got the permission of this visit; the „Politruk” Tamara Dobrin overtly told her a bit later that she herself had signed the expelling. / 1954-1968. Scientific Researcher at the Institute of Psychology of the Academy („Preparator” --- lowest degree --, Researcher, Senior Researcher, Head of Laboratory (of Language Behaviour „Limbaj”), Head of Section (of General Psychology/ 1954-1968. Scientific Researcher at the Institute of Psychology of the Academy („Preparator” --- lowest degree --, Researcher, Senior Researcher, Head of Laboratory (of Language Behaviour „Limbaj”), Head of Section (of General Psychology)).

/1968-1980 The Deputy-Minister, Prof. Dr. Jean Livescu invites her at the Ministery of Education and informs about te decision to „bring” her back at the University, due to the fact she was much eulogized by Soviet experts who delivered postuniversity courses for the Teachers of Foreign Languages (he repeated what they said : ”You have such an international „specialist” as Professor TSC why are you inviting us?”). Her answer was that she would only come back as according to her right, i.e.as a „Full Professor”, and not nominated by the Ministery, but discussed and agreed by the Faculty Council and voted by the Univ. Senate. She had been asked to present a Plan for her Course, and therefore, while asking to be nominated at the Faculty of Letters, and not of Psychology (where there were too many machinations and no authority, after M. Ralea died in 1963), she elaborated a Plan for two connected and quite new Courses in Romania: „Psycholinguistics”: and: ”Applied Linguistics”. In the Senate Session, an opposition was organized by the political „Activist” and quite deprived of any scientifuc work Tamara Dobrin, but Al. Rosetti said just a few enthusiastic words, while Acad. Grigore Moisil (much appreciated Mathematician and supporter of Linguistics and of Automatic Translations) said that the famous Roman Jakobson spoke about her with high appreciation. The result was a success, also because there were: 4 negative votes, a proof that it wasn’t – as usually --- a politically obligation for unanimity”. The same and other intrigues acted at the Ministery, hence the final official nomination was only delivered after one year. She gave in „premičre” Courses and Seminars of „Psycholinguistics”, and then also on „Applied Linguistics” (also connecting them, after 1971, with the newly creation of GRLA and the affiliation to AILA).

/1979 nominated by France Government (Giscard D’Estaing) Professor at the. Univ. of Paris Sorbonne, repeated nomination in 1980, but the Ministery didn’t permit the leave (not even for 6 months as she had asked); finally, asked for anticipated retirement (a kind of resignation – unused in the Dictatorship!), the leave was admitted, for only 4 months, Febr. - June 1980. Delivered her Course („Psycholinguistics”, and „Applied Linguistics --- see the book 1984) in the Institute of Linguistics in Paris
/ 1980 nominated „Prof.Consultant ”(Emeritus). in absence, with no application for it.
/ 1980 - present, Prof. Consultant [Emeritus Professor], Univ. Buc., Fac. Letters]
/1969 - present Director of Doctorates in Psychology (Fac. of Psychology), 1971 also in Linguistics (Fac. of Letters).

C. System of Scientific Conception. A conception envisaging the „Human” as a whole, of Language not as a „living organism”,independent(an obsolete conception), but existing inside,within the Human ---in his/her bio-psycho-social reality Preoccupied by the connexion between Science and Reality,which the first should serve ,hence of the applications in practical life (improving Communication,Language teaching,correct use of Romanian Language ,counteracting manipulatory stratagems,etc.). A continually respected theoretical princeps Postulate :«starting from Reality,in this context respectively,from the reality of the concrete act of communication via language behaviour ,brought her to create,formulate in a system,apply in practical life ,validate (via research,publications, international acknowledgement, see e.g. infra 5,6 etc.) : The CONTEXTUAL-DYNAMIC Theory and Methodology (CDTM) : a)a new Model of theAct of Communication (starting from the REALITY of this Act);b),the first transformation of static Structuralism, by demonstrating the possibility of noticing the «DYNAMIC »character of Structure(cf. infra,1957 Art.7);c)modification of the ”Scheme of Communication” (with the first inclusion of Emitter/Receiver in the reality,hence IN CONTEXT; d) The first scientific extension of the concept CONTEXT and its systematic development(cf.infra,Books, 3,4),with the „subordinated spheres”of the «Contextual Levels»(Explicit, Implicit, Linguistic-Situational, Verbal-Nonverbal); e)demonstration of the existence of the Act of « ContextYual Organization of Emission» and of «Contextual Interpretation of Message Reception » etc. ;f)The study of Communication in the Dynamics of Reception as an individual act (of a certain moment or in ontogenezis ), or a historical one, and of the Dynamics of Message Construction - DCM ; g)The first research on (registered) Dialogue in children ,and generally new studies on the «Structure of Dialogue».etc..h) Continuous applications and new validations of DCTM)(CDTM) in the Analysis of Literary Text, then in other areas(e.g.recently on Architecture ,see Art.s)

9 EDITORIAL BOARDS
(Selection :Member in some prestigious ones, Leadership-Director,Editor-in-Chief a.o.).
---„International journal of psycholinguistics”(IJPL),1972-1980, 1993---, Editor-in-Chief. În 1972,invited by Ed.Mouton,Haga,TSC created alone this new Journal(first issues commonn with „Linguistics”),the only one in the Field ,which got a great prestige She formed by invitation the Committee(Roman Jakobson,Jean .Piaget---by his own request---,-,G.Miller, a .o. remarkable personalities),she made the design of the cover (also creating the first abbreviation and the symbolic one of PL i.e. ΨΛ) she organized thev way of cooperation with authors and especially the Publisher (NO model about ,in Romania under Dictatorship and dominating Politics and Securitatea ; the e-mail facilities didn’t yet exist,she had no Secretariat,she paid all herself at Postoffice, it was impossible--- mostly because politically dangerous---- to have communication by phone abroad). She had asked,at Univ..Buc,the agreement ,quite necessary for receiving a bulk of correspondence from abroad and to send the composed issues, etc. (a formal agreement was given to her for Post office and Custom,signed by Rector).It became more and more difficult to resist :to many political impediments,often sent bacl from Postoffice because new rules imposed new recommendations , etc. ,and maybe also local(outside probably too !) gealousies acted ;besides,Mouton Publishers had an unexpected evolution (included into DeGruyter ,from Berlin), the Journal’s diffusion was no more well done by Publisher. In 198o she suspended the publication ( 24-th issue), keeping her right of going on being the „Editor-in-Chief” and the copy-right. After 1990,Japanese colleagues insisted in inviting her to publish a new series in Japan ,finding there the necessary financial support in the”Academic Socieies”. TSC agreed ,went to Japan directly from a good Congress in wonderful Banff,had hard negociations in Osaka,kept her complete independence ,and the first issue re-appeared in1993 (including a study too,by which she wanted to make the scientific community aware of part of the horrors lived by a majority under the cover of such an ideology and regimc(cf.”IJPL”,1[28]1993, about „untrue dialogues”,i.e.interrogations under torture,for which she had got inspiration from a paper delivered-and offered to her--by Johann Jakobs at Basel Conference of „IADA”,and which dealt with former political trials in South Africa). Now she was free to travel,and cooperated well with Japanese Publisher..
